I found another small glitch. When travelling eastbound crossing time zones, the TND says you are entering the time zone you just left and takes an hour off the clock. This time error lasts for up to 10 minutes until the unit quietly changes the time back to reality. This has happened to me twice in the past few days. I crossed into CDT and it said I was entering MDT, then yesterday I crossed into EDT and it said I was entering CDT. I don't know if it does the same thing westbound (yet). It worked fine before the update though. Weird huh?

There are some routing issues if you are going inner city it takes you past your exit and then circles you back to the exit you just passed
Example
1897 harbor ave
Memphis tn
If you are north bound on 55 it's exit 11 presidents island but TND takes you to the next exit and circles you back to exit 11
South bound it works fine it's a north bound issue
That's just one example of about 5 or so similar issue just in the inner city
